What are some key features of the O'Connor neighbourhood?
O'Connor is an affluent Canberra suburb known for its leafy, heritage‑listed streets and a mix of historic homes such as the Tocumwal houses. The area includes the Bruce/O'Connor ridge nature reserve, district playing fields for soccer, rugby and cricket, and a small shopping centre with a pub, grocery, restaurants and a pharmacy.
